SingleTablePolymorphism.java
package org.codefilarete.stalactite.engine.configurer.model;
import java.util.Map;
import java.util.Set;
import org.codefilarete.stalactite.sql.ddl.structure.Column;
import org.codefilarete.stalactite.sql.ddl.structure.Table;
import org.codefilarete.tool.collection.KeepOrderMap;
import org.codefilarete.tool.collection.KeepOrderSet;
/**
* All subclasses share the parent table. A discriminator column distinguishes rows by their runtime type.
*
* @param <C> parent entity type
* @param <I> identifier type
* @param <D> discriminator value type (e.g. {@link String}, {@link Integer})
* @param <T> the shared table type
*/
public class SingleTablePolymorphism<C, I, D, T extends Table<T>> implements EntityPolymorphism<C, I> {
/** The shared table (same as rootEntity.getTable()) */
private final Column<T, D> discriminatorColumn;
/** Sub-entities keyed by their discriminator value. Insertion order is preserved for test stability. */
private final Map<D, Mapping<? extends C, T>> subEntitiesPerDiscriminator = new KeepOrderMap<>();
public SingleTablePolymorphism(Column<T, D> discriminatorColumn) {
this.discriminatorColumn = discriminatorColumn;
}
public Column<T, D> getDiscriminatorColumn() {
return discriminatorColumn;
}
public void addSubEntity(D discriminatorValue, Mapping<? extends C, T> subEntity) {
subEntitiesPerDiscriminator.put(discriminatorValue, subEntity);
}
public Map<D, Mapping<? extends C, T>> getSubEntitiesPerDiscriminator() {
return subEntitiesPerDiscriminator;
}
/** Returns the discriminator value associated with the given subclass type. */
public D getDiscriminatorValue(Class<? extends C> subType) {
return subEntitiesPerDiscriminator.entrySet().stream()
.filter(e -> e.getValue().getEntityType().equals(subType))
.map(Map.Entry::getKey)
.findFirst()
.orElseThrow(() -> new IllegalArgumentException("No discriminator value found for type: " + subType));
}
@Override
public Set<Mapping<? extends C, ?>> getSubEntities() {
return new KeepOrderSet<>(subEntitiesPerDiscriminator.values());
}
}
